What is ecological succession?

Back

A slow change in an environment.

What are pioneer species?

Back

The first organisms to colonize an area and begin the process of ecological succession.

What is the role of pioneer species in ecological succession?

Back

They prepare the environment for other species by breaking down rock and creating soil.

What is primary succession?

Back

The process of ecological succession that occurs in lifeless areas where soil has not yet formed.
